Hatters Hit The Jackpot With First Championship Game Of The New Season

|
Image for Hatters Hit The Jackpot With First Championship Game Of The New Season

After back-to-back promotion campaigns, the Hatters support were, this morning, eagerly waiting to see who their side would take on in their opening fixture of the new season.

At 09:00 hours this morning it was revealed that the Hatters will be at home for the first fixture when they take on Middlesbrough, at Kenilworth Road.

The game will take place on Friday 2nd August with it, presumably, being covered live by Sky Sports.

The opening day fixture also pits together two managers who will be taking charge of their first competitive games for their new clubs, with Graeme Jones in charge at Luton and Jonathan Woodgate in charge at Middlesbrough.

The fixture will give the Hatters support an early indication of how their side will fare in the Championship with Middlesbrough, last season, being in the promotion race until the last few games of the season.
